What is MPPT and Why It Matters in Solar Systems

Solar panels operate at peak efficiency only under specific conditions. This is where MPPT comes in, a sophisticated technology that ensures your solar system performs at its best regardless of environmental changes.

Understanding solar maximum power point tracking:

Maximum Power Point Tracking (MPPT) is an advanced electronic technology that continuously adjusts the electrical operating point of solar panels to extract maximum available power. The relationship between current and voltage in a solar panel forms a curve, with a specific point where power output peaks, the Maximum Power Point.

However, this point shifts throughout the day as sunlight intensity, temperature, and panel conditions change. Without proper tracking, your system would operate below its potential, wasting valuable energy.

Furthermore, MPPT controllers can improve charging efficiency by 10-30% compared to traditional PWM controllers. This is particularly important in varying weather conditions, where MPPT continuously monitors panel output and adjusts accordingly to maintain optimal performance.

The role of MPPT in energy conversion:

The primary function of MPPT is to maximise the efficiency of energy conversion from solar panels to usable electricity. It achieves this by:

  • Dynamically adjusting to real-time changes in sunlight intensity and temperature
  • Converting higher voltage DC from panels to a lower voltage needed for batteries
  • Optimising power output even during partial shading or panel mismatches

MPPT operates through sophisticated algorithms that continuously track the MPP as conditions vary. These algorithms precisely adjust the solar panels' operating point, boosting output power and extending system longevity. Various methods are employed for MPPT control, including fuzzy logic and artificial neural networks. Consequently, MPPT technology can increase energy yield by up to 30% compared to systems without it, making it a vital component in modern solar applications.

Why traditional inverters fall short:

Traditional inverters, particularly those using Pulse Width Modulation (PWM), are less efficient than MPPT inverters. PWM inverters switch the output voltage on and off to maintain the desired voltage level, rather than optimising the entire power curve.

In contrast, MPPT inverters continuously adjust the voltage and current to maintain peak efficiency. This becomes particularly important in challenging conditions such as:

  1. Low light situations (mornings, evenings, cloudy days)
  2. Temperature variations (cold weather can increase panel voltage)
  3. Partial shading scenarios where some panels receive less light

Under cold conditions, for instance, a solar panel's voltage can rise to around 18V while the battery may be at 12V. An MPPT system can convert this voltage difference into a 20-45% power gain in winter, whereas a PWM system would waste this potential energy. Generally, MPPT technology excels at adapting to changing environmental conditions, making it the superior choice for maximising solar energy output in real-world situations.

Maximum power point tracking algorithm:

At the heart of Eastman's technology lies a sophisticated algorithm that continuously samples the current-voltage curve of connected solar panels. The system employs a method that systematically adjusts the operating voltage, measures the resulting power output, and moves toward the voltage that yields maximum power. This iterative process happens multiple times per second, enabling the system to respond almost instantly to changing conditions.

Moreover, Eastman's algorithm includes additional intelligence to handle partial shading scenarios, where conventional MPPT methods often struggle. When some panels receive less light than others, multiple power peaks can appear on the curve. Eastman's technology can identify the actual global maximum rather than getting trapped at a local peak, significantly increasing energy yield during challenging weather.

High MPPT efficiency: Eastman's maximum power point tracking technology achieves an impressive 98.5% efficiency rate. This extraordinary precision means virtually all available solar energy is captured and converted, even under challenging environmental conditions. Indeed, the tracking accuracy reaches 99.5%, ensuring minimal energy loss throughout the conversion process.

Low DC startup voltage for early energy capture: The system starts operating with minimal input power, enabling energy harvesting during low-light periods such as dawn and dusk. Hence, your solar setup starts generating electricity earlier in the morning and continues producing later into the evening, ultimately extending daily production hours.

DC overloading capacity: Eastman's inverters can handle DC input power up to 30% above their rated capacity. Since most solar brands allow DC overloading of 25-50%, this feature optimises system performance by accommodating brief power surges during peak sunlight without shutting down.

Wide AC voltage range for grid adaptability: The wide AC voltage range ensures seamless adjustment to grid fluctuations while maintaining optimal operation regardless of electricity demand throughout the day. This adaptability proves especially valuable in regions with unstable grid conditions.

Type II SPD for surge protection: Dual-side Type II Surge Protective Devices shield both AC and DC components, safeguarding your investment against voltage spikes from lightning or grid disturbances. Ideally, these SPDs are installed near the inverter to provide comprehensive system protection.
